Job Description:

HPC Systems/Software Engineer needs to understand cluster concepts and required manageability functionalities for large scale clusters containing thousands of servers. HPC Cluster Management software takes care of OS provisioning, controlling and monitoring.

Job Responsibility:

  • Designs enhancements, updates, and programming changes for portions and subsystems of systems software
  • Analyzes design and determines coding, programming, and integration activities required
  • Writes and executes complete testing plans, protocols, and documentation
  • Leads a project team of other software systems engineers
  • Collaborates and communicates with management and development partners
  • Represents the software systems engineering team for all phases of development projects
  • Provides guidance and mentoring to less-experienced staff members

Requirements:

  • Bachelor's or Master's degree in Computer Science, Information Systems, or equivalent
  • Typically 6+ years experience
  • Expertise in multiple software systems design tools and languages
  • Strong analytical and problem solving skills
  • Designing software systems running on multiple platform types
  • Should have very good systems knowledge including hardware, firmware and Operating System
  • Linux systems knowledge with Python and other languages
  • Good understanding of Network boot technologies (PXE or gPXE/Etherboot etc)
  • Storage specific knowledge: LVM, RAID, iSCSI, Disk partitioning (GPT, MBR)
  • Exposure to Opensource community and software
  • Experience with GNU Make, CI/CD systems such as Jenkins, GitHub Actions, etc.
  • Excellent written and verbal communication skills
  • mastery in English and local language

Nice to have:

Knowledge of shared storage like CFS and High Availability solutions is a plus
